From the linked article:
"A market seems to be emerging for Bitcoin Cash that looks to be relatively robust," he told the BBC.
There is hardly a "Robust" market in Bitcoin Cash. The only BCH being traded is coin that was split from Bitcoin that was being stored on currency exchanges, a relativly small amount as many traders pulled their coin off exchanges pending the split. Most Bitcoin (and Bitcoin Cash) is held in private wallets. There won't be true price discovery until exchanges begin accepting BCH deposits and set up trading pairs.
